The Grand Theft Auto V affair was an incident involving several micronationalists which centred on the underage Amelie Björk owning the mature game Grand Theft Auto V. The affair began on 28 January 2020, when Jayden Lycon confronted Montan with a sarcastic message, with Zabëlle Skye and Amelie Björk then joining. The affair escalated on 4 February 2020 after intervention by Aidan McGrath. The conflict ended the following day, and Montan uninstalled the game soon after the controversy died down.

The affair spawned various pop culture mediums, including a film and expansion for the game 911 Operator. Since the incident, various attempts were made to alert the Coast Guard relating to other underage players playing Grand Theft Auto V, with minimal to no response from the organization (except on 15 October 2020; see below).

Background

Grand Theft Auto V is a 2013 action-adventure game developed by Rockstar North and published by Rockstar Games.[1][2] The Entertainment Software Rating Board, also known as the ESRB, rated this game as mature, due to its use of blood, nudity, language, alcohol, etc.[3] On 26 January 2020, Björk complained to TOES concerning his slow download speed when downloading the game.[4][5] This was noticed by Lycon and was later confirmed by Montan on 27 January 2020. As Montan was 13 at the time and the ESRB having jurisdiction in his area (that being North America), it would have been against the rating to play the game.[6][7]
